Kathy & Mo Take To the Stage at Trustus Through 7/24
The 25th Anniversary season of Trustus theatre would not be complete without Parallel Lives: The Kathy & Mo Show by Mo Gaffney & Kathy Najimy and starring Dewey Scott-Wiley and Elena Martinez-Vidal.
This stalwart comedy has delighted audiences at Trustus in the past and will do so once again. We encounter two Supreme Beings planning the beginning of the world. Once they have decided on the color scheme of the races, a little concerned that white people will feel slighted being such a boring color, they create sex and the sexes. Afraid women will have too many advantages; the Beings decide to make childbirth painful and to give men enormous egos as compensation. From this moment on, the audience is whisked through the outrageous universe of Kathy & Mo with laughs coming a mile a minute.
